Northwest Territory, Historical territory in eastern United States.

Northwest Territory was a territory of the United States lying east of the Mississippi and north of the Ohio River, stretching from the Great Lakes down to the border between modern Indiana and Kentucky. It covered present-day Ohio, Indiana, Illinois, Michigan, Wisconsin, and part of Minnesota.

The United States created it in 1787 through the Northwest Ordinance, which set rules for forming new states and settling western lands. Ohio became the first state carved from it in 1803, followed by Indiana, Illinois, Michigan, and Wisconsin over the following decades.

The name comes from the region lying northwest of the Ohio River, which then marked the western edge of the original states. Settlers brought European town names and built communities modeled on New England villages with central greens and meeting houses.

Museums in Marietta and other founding towns display maps, documents, and objects from the territorial period. Visitors can drive along the Ohio River through old settlements and see reconstructed log cabins and forts.

The Northwest Ordinance banned slavery in all future states formed from this region, creating the first legally defined free zone in North America. Rivers served as natural borders, so the Ohio became the dividing line between free and slaveholding regions.
